✦ Synopsis


Recently, Lebon and Lambermont proposed a general variational principle for fluid mechanics, In this paper, the criterion is applied to steady and non-steady stagnation flows; the plane and the axisymmetrical cases are considered. By using Glansdorff-Prigogine self consistent method, approximate analytic solutions are derived. It is shown that the steady solution is rather quickly reached. For this latter case, the present solutions are compared with previous ones obtained by direct integration of the Navier-Stokes equations. § 1. Introduction
